Long live ficus! (1936) a bitter, ironic novel, largely autobiographical The main character is Gordon Comstock, an unrecognized poet, a loser writer, forced to serve in an advertising agency to earn a living. He has a real talent for composing slogans, but his work disgusts him, it seems a caricature of literary creativity. He despises the material values and vulgarity of everyday life, the symbol of which becomes the ficus on the window. In all his failures, he blames money, but proud poverty only leads him into the depths of depression... Comstock needs to understand that in addition to high art, there are simple joys, and there is nothing shameful in the desire to earn money. What will save him? Translated by Vera Domiteeva
